面向軟件工程的工作流管理系統(tǒng)研究
本文關(guān)鍵詞:面向軟件工程的工作流管理系統(tǒng),由筆耕文化傳播整理發(fā)布。
第3 3卷第 1 1期 VoL3 3 NO . 11
企業(yè)技術(shù)開發(fā) TECHNOI』 ( ) GI CAL DEVELOPMENT OF ENTERP RI S E
2 0 1 4年 4月 Ap r . 201 4
面向軟件工程的工作流管理系統(tǒng)研究 孫國(guó)志 (同濟(jì)大學(xué),上海 2 0 0 0 9 2 ) 摘要:以工作流管理系統(tǒng)為管理模型參考,建立起面向軟件工程的管理模型基礎(chǔ)是目前軟件工程項(xiàng)目的重要研究?jī)?nèi)容。
文章主要探討了軟件工程和工作流管理系統(tǒng)的主要內(nèi)容,并對(duì)面向軟件工程的工作流管理系統(tǒng)進(jìn)行了實(shí)例分析。
關(guān)鍵詞:軟件工程;工作流管理系統(tǒng);研究分析 中圖分類號(hào): T P 3 1 1 文獻(xiàn)標(biāo)識(shí)碼: A 文章編號(hào): 1 0 0 6— 8 9 3 7 ( 2 0 1 4 ) 1 1— 0 0 6 3— 0 2
為了提高軟件工程開發(fā)軟件的專業(yè)化和標(biāo)準(zhǔn)化程度, 2基于軟件工程的工作流管理系統(tǒng)實(shí)例研究軟件企業(yè)應(yīng)該為軟件工程建立起一套方便管理的系統(tǒng),根據(jù)規(guī)范去進(jìn)行軟件開發(fā)操作。雖然目前軟件市場(chǎng)上存在著總體上講,軟件工程的工作流管理系統(tǒng)構(gòu)建有三階段軟件開發(fā)管理的模板,但這些模板遠(yuǎn)遠(yuǎn)不夠科學(xué)地管理軟完成:工作流建模階段、工作流仿真 (模型實(shí)例化 )、工作流工作流建模階段,相關(guān)人員分析企業(yè)性質(zhì)和生件,因而軟件開發(fā)公司要對(duì)當(dāng)前的管理模式進(jìn)行適當(dāng)?shù)卣{(diào)實(shí)施階段。整,改變?cè)纫援a(chǎn)品研發(fā)為核心的管理模式,轉(zhuǎn)向以過(guò)程產(chǎn)步驟為基礎(chǔ),人性化操作為管理手段,模擬企業(yè)經(jīng)營(yíng)管 為主的方式,建立工作流管理系統(tǒng)。
理,將管理活動(dòng)計(jì)算機(jī)化;工作流仿真階段,相關(guān)人員設(shè)置節(jié)點(diǎn)基本參數(shù),并配置資源,從而確定管理使用權(quán)限;工作流實(shí)施階段,相關(guān)人員在前兩個(gè)工作基礎(chǔ)上,執(zhí)行企業(yè)生
產(chǎn)和經(jīng)營(yíng)管理各項(xiàng)指標(biāo),為工作流管理系統(tǒng)中的人際交互 1 . 1工作流管理系統(tǒng)定義工作流管理系統(tǒng)是一個(gè)善于進(jìn)行過(guò)程管理的軟件系界面和實(shí)踐應(yīng)用功能完成最終整合優(yōu)化職能。 統(tǒng),不是企業(yè)的業(yè)務(wù)系統(tǒng)而是企業(yè)為業(yè)務(wù)系統(tǒng)的運(yùn)行提供為了更加明確面向軟件工程的工作流管理系統(tǒng)研究,下軟件支撐環(huán)境的系統(tǒng)。工作人員在系統(tǒng)工作之前預(yù)先設(shè)定文主要列舉了為支持P _ P R O C E模型開發(fā)的工作流管理系好工作邏輯以方便進(jìn)行工作流實(shí)際工作,實(shí)現(xiàn)它預(yù)定完成統(tǒng)。
該系統(tǒng)的結(jié)構(gòu)圖如圖1所示:可見(jiàn),該系統(tǒng)由建模仿真、 實(shí)施三大部分組成,體現(xiàn)了工作流建模到工作流仿真到最后工作量管理。 1 . 2工作流管理系統(tǒng)的主要分類工作流管理系統(tǒng)根據(jù)工作流本身的工作特點(diǎn)主要有四種比較分類,適用于不同的工作對(duì)象。
工作流實(shí)施的具體過(guò)程,還展示了其他組成部分。 圖形用戶界面
第一種為結(jié)構(gòu)化工作流和即席工作流,結(jié)構(gòu)化工作流主要執(zhí)行在實(shí)際工作中重復(fù)某個(gè)固定步驟的業(yè)務(wù),在大量的辦公工作中會(huì)使用,即席工作流主要適用于沒(méi)有大量重 復(fù)性或者重復(fù)性較弱的過(guò)程處理。
l 建摸實(shí)施
工作流建模 —
工作i橢真
工
產(chǎn)品 l資源 網(wǎng)網(wǎng)價(jià) 褻集 囊工 —
第二種為面向文檔和面向過(guò)程的工作流比較,面向文檔的工作流廣泛應(yīng)用于文檔管理,將電子格式的文檔和圖片分發(fā)與不同的工作人員進(jìn)行業(yè)務(wù)操作,面向過(guò)程的工作
過(guò)程
i耳
一
一
行
組織 l度量
l
仿真堿 J
流是將具體工作細(xì)分每一個(gè)環(huán)節(jié)都有需要處理的數(shù)據(jù)對(duì)象,這些數(shù)據(jù)對(duì)象根據(jù)需要會(huì)發(fā)送到其他的環(huán)節(jié)中去。 第三種是基于郵件和基于數(shù)據(jù)庫(kù)的工作流比較,基于郵件的適合低端系統(tǒng)執(zhí)行過(guò)程中消息的傳遞、數(shù)據(jù)的分發(fā)與事件的通知,基于數(shù)據(jù)庫(kù)的適合高端且規(guī)模大的系統(tǒng), 執(zhí)行所以數(shù)據(jù)的查詢與處理。 第四種是任務(wù)推動(dòng)與目標(biāo)拉動(dòng)的工作流比較分類,前者的特點(diǎn)是逐步進(jìn)行,一個(gè)環(huán)節(jié)接連著下一環(huán)節(jié)只有當(dāng)上個(gè)環(huán)節(jié)處理完畢后下一個(gè)環(huán)節(jié)才會(huì)被激活繼續(xù)處理工作,后者是將業(yè)務(wù)流程視為目標(biāo)過(guò)程實(shí)例執(zhí)行時(shí),該目標(biāo)將被分解得到多個(gè)相互之間按一定約束條件的關(guān)聯(lián)起來(lái)的可執(zhí)行的多個(gè)環(huán)節(jié),其中各環(huán)節(jié)還可以當(dāng)成是子目標(biāo)而進(jìn)一步進(jìn)行分解,當(dāng)各環(huán)節(jié)均執(zhí)行完畢之后,整個(gè)過(guò)程也 一
碾絡(luò)環(huán)境、c o n{且 f牛 I
(一 工作流模型庫(kù)系統(tǒng)資源庫(kù)
( 仿真數(shù)據(jù)庫(kù)
< - - - — 工作流實(shí)例庫(kù)
(一 — 文檔、 代碼庫(kù)
圖 1基于軟件工程的工作流管理系統(tǒng)結(jié)構(gòu)圖
2 . 1工作流建模
工作流建模是為了實(shí)現(xiàn)對(duì)軟件開發(fā)工作流的定制,主要包括過(guò)程建模、系統(tǒng)維護(hù)和對(duì)外接口三個(gè)模塊。過(guò)程建模是建立項(xiàng)目層次信息和工作流層次,在建模過(guò)程中需要編輯各個(gè)活動(dòng)屬性和各個(gè)活動(dòng)之間的
執(zhí)行關(guān)系,在模板中
自動(dòng)生成工作流。在模板的執(zhí)行工作確定無(wú)誤后,工作人 員還需要設(shè)置檢驗(yàn)這一環(huán)節(jié),對(duì)模板的工作效益進(jìn)行校準(zhǔn),具體操作可以采取連通性測(cè)試算法等,程序工作人員還需注意將仿真信息添加至建立的模塊中,,避免執(zhí)行工作流仿真時(shí)的重新建模,減少工作量,只需要為仿真功能的
就完成了。 作者簡(jiǎn)介:孫國(guó)志 ( 1 9 8 3一 ),男,內(nèi)蒙古包頭市人,碩士研究生,研究 方向:軟件工程。
本文關(guān)鍵詞:面向軟件工程的工作流管理系統(tǒng),由筆耕文化傳播整理發(fā)布。
本文編號(hào):129884
本文鏈接:http://sikaile.net/kejilunwen/ruanjiangongchenglunwen/129884.html